site?Oh, sorry for the confusion. The last parameter is for the "Slug header" - 
that is to say, the original filename. You can make something sensible up if 
you don't have one (foo.jpg). It doesn't have to be an actual path to a file. 
It's just used as the default title and some other bits of 
meta-data.Cheers,-Jeff
